What do you need before opening a flower shop

Before opening a flower shop, a series of preparations need to be made. The following is an overview of some key steps and required items: 1. Market research and positioning

Understand market demand: Study the demand and competition situation of the local flower market, determine the target customer group and positioning.

Determine business strategy: Based on market research results, develop suitable business strategies, such as product types, price positioning, marketing methods, etc. 2、 Store location selection and decoration

Site selection: Choose a location with high foot traffic, convenient transportation, and in line with the consumption habits of the target customer group as the store location.

Rent and Contract: Negotiate rent and lease term with the landlord, and sign a lease agreement.

Decoration design: Based on the store's positioning and style, carry out decoration design, including walls, floors, lighting, shelves, etc.

Decoration construction: Choose a reliable decoration company or construction team to carry out decoration construction, ensuring the quality and progress of decoration. 3、 Document processing and qualification application

Business License: Apply for a business license from the local industrial and commercial department to prove that the flower shop has legal business qualifications.

Tax registration certificate: After obtaining the business license, go through the tax registration procedures with the local tax department and obtain the tax registration certificate.

Health certificate: If the flower shop is involved in food sales and requires health certificates for employees, it should ensure that the relevant personnel handle the health certificate.

Hygiene License: As flower shops involve plant cultivation and sales, they need to meet certain hygiene standards and obtain a hygiene license.

Fire Permit: Passed the fire safety inspection and obtained the fire permit.

Other documents: Depending on the management requirements of different regions, additional relevant documents such as environmental permits may need to be obtained. 4、 Preparation of spare parts and materials

Basic equipment: Purchase basic equipment such as showerheads, scissors, deburring tools, packaging paper, gift boxes, flower racks, etc.

Cashier system: Install a cashier system to facilitate customer payment and store management.

Preservation equipment: Purchase preservation cabinets, refrigeration equipment, etc. as needed to preserve fresh flowers and green plants.

Decorative items: Purchase some decorative items such as vases, flower pots, etc. for displaying and showcasing products. 5、 Purchasing and Inventory Management

Finding suppliers: Look for reliable flower and plant suppliers to establish stable cooperative relationships.

First time purchase: Based on market demand and store positioning, make the first purchase.

Inventory management: Establish an inventory management system to ensure that the inventory of fresh flowers and green plants is sufficient and not excessive. 6、 Employee Recruitment and Training

Recruiting employees: Recruit suitable employees based on the size of the store and business needs.

Training employees: Provide training on floral knowledge, sales skills, customer service, and other aspects to employees. 7、 Opening event planning and execution

Develop an opening activity plan: Based on the store's positioning and target customer group, develop an opening activity plan.

Promotion: Promote through online self media and offline flyers.

Execution of opening activities: Carry out opening activities according to the activity plan to attract customer attention and consumption.

Before opening a flower shop, it is necessary to do a series of preparatory work, including market research, store location and decoration, certificate processing and qualification application, preparation of spare parts and materials, procurement and inventory management, employee recruitment and training, and planning and execution of opening activities. These tasks will lay a solid foundation for the smooth opening and subsequent operation of the flower shop.
